我们先来做小鸟的飞行扇翅膀的动画,这是一个造型切换的动画,一共有两个造型,重复切换即可,经过多次测试,等待的时长为0.2秒是最合适的,翅膀扇的速度比较合适。

接下来做的是小鸟的这段动画插入到相册里去。先让小鸟以藏起来,等待10秒(跳过片头和第一张图片的时长),开始显示,扇动翅膀,5秒后消失,也就是再次隐藏就可以了。怎么确定小鸟扇动的这5秒呢?

我们需要修改脚本,我们只能用重复多少次的脚本来控制,如果等待时长为0.2的话,5秒就应该扇动翅膀25次才对,因此,重复的次数是25次。这个应该是很好理解的吧?当然,经过调试,我们发现,计算的精确的时间,小鸟出现在了第3张图片上,我们只想让它在地张显示,为了减少大量的改动脚本,采取压缩重复的次数来解决,我们只重复20次,减少5次,也就是4秒的时候消失,正好当图片再第5秒切换后,看不到小鸟的残影。这是一个不断微调的过程。

3张图片直接隐藏可以吗?经过测试,直接隐藏的话,因为缺少了5秒的时长,所以直接显示为空白,这不太符合我们的预期,所以,还是需要添加等待5秒这个积木的。我在调试的过程中,把等待时长调为1秒,这样效果来的更明显,等合适了再把时长改过来,改成5秒就可以了。

说到对时长的控制,一定要有些耐心,不要因为计算时长需要精确到秒就耐不住性子,变得不耐烦。话又说回来,这无非是一些20以内的加减法,一年级的小孩子的计算能力算不上难,我们需要更多的是耐心。

查看原文 >>
相关文章